World Builder  1.1.0-pre
A geodynamic initial conditions generator
WorldBuilder::Features::Interface Member List

This is the complete list of members for WorldBuilder::Features::Interface, including all inherited members.

bezier_curveWorldBuilder::Features::Interfaceprotected
composition_submodule_nameWorldBuilder::Features::Interfaceprotected
coordinatesWorldBuilder::Features::Interfaceprotected
create(const std::string &name, WorldBuilder::World *world)WorldBuilder::Features::Interfacestatic
declare_entries(Parameters &prm, const std::string &parent_name, const std::vector< std::string > &required_entries)WorldBuilder::Features::Interfacestatic
distance_to_feature_plane(const Point< 3 > &position_in_cartesian_coordinates, const Objects::NaturalCoordinate &position_in_natural_coordinates, const double depth) constWorldBuilder::Features::Interfacevirtual
get_coordinates(const std::string &name, Parameters &prm, const CoordinateSystem coordinate_system)WorldBuilder::Features::Interface
get_declare_map()WorldBuilder::Features::Interfaceinlineprivatestatic
get_factory_map()WorldBuilder::Features::Interfaceinlineprivatestatic
get_name() constWorldBuilder::Features::Interfaceinline
get_snippet_map()WorldBuilder::Features::Interfaceinlineprivatestatic
Interface()WorldBuilder::Features::Interface
interpolation_typeWorldBuilder::Features::Interfaceprotected
nameWorldBuilder::Features::Interfaceprotected
original_number_of_coordinatesWorldBuilder::Features::Interfaceprotected
parse_entries(Parameters &prm)=0WorldBuilder::Features::Interfacepure virtual
properties(const Point< 3 > &position_in_cartesian_coordinates, const Objects::NaturalCoordinate &position_in_natural_coordinates, const double depth, const std::vector< std::array< unsigned int, 3 >> &properties, const double gravity, const std::vector< size_t > &entry_in_output, std::vector< double > &output) const =0WorldBuilder::Features::Interfacepure virtual
registerType(const std::string &name, void(*)(Parameters &, const std::string &, const std::vector< std::string > &required_entries), void(*make_snippet)(Parameters &), ObjectFactory *factory)WorldBuilder::Features::Interfacestatic
tag_indexWorldBuilder::Features::Interfaceprotected
temperature_submodule_nameWorldBuilder::Features::Interfaceprotected
worldWorldBuilder::Features::Interfaceprotected
~Interface()WorldBuilder::Features::Interfacevirtual